Transaction ac81e500015874dcd009a62313e414194231b6f6e25b5c8e6fa15921af0809b8
1 Input
1 Output
-
ac81e500015874dcd009a62313e414194231b6f6e25b5c8e6fa15921af0809b8:0
- value
- 3126252
- script pubkey
- OP_0 OP_PUSHBYTES_20 f9dd678440e4f33888c874c51c2dd7775ff0c9aa
- address
- bc1ql8wk0pzqunen3zxgwnz3ctwhwa0lpjd2dsnt0a